Re: Oops: Null pointer dereference in ReiserFS when under heavy load.

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



2009/7/7, Christian Kujau <lists@xxxxxxxxxxxxxxx>:
> On Sun, 5 Jul 2009, "Jérôme M. Berger" wrote:
>  > > Jun 15 23:18:02 rover kernel: BUG: unable to handle kernel NULL pointer
>  > > dereference at 0000000000000018
>  > > Jun 15 23:18:02 rover kernel: IP: [<ffffffff80227a85>]
>  > > __ticket_spin_lock+0x5/0x20
>
>  Hm, this looks like http://bugzilla.kernel.org/show_bug.cgi?id=13556 to
>  me, maybe it's the same issue?
>
>  If so: @Michael, do you still experience these oopses or has the bug
>  somehow magically resolved for you?
Bug is rock stable :(. Below the latest oops from kernel 2.6.30.1.
Configuration is same as in my report.


BUG: unable to handle kernel NULL pointer dereference at 0000000000000018
IP: [<ffffffff805c456a>] _spin_lock_irq+0xa/0x20
PGD 7a939067 PUD 7a8a1067 PMD 0
Oops: 0002 [#1] SMP
last sysfs file: /sys/kernel/uevent_seqnum
CPU 0
Pid: 1551, comm: reiserfs/0 Not tainted 2.6.30.1-netconsole #1 EP45T-DS3
RIP: 0010:[<ffffffff805c456a>]  [<ffffffff805c456a>] _spin_lock_irq+0xa/0x20
RSP: 0018:ffff88007e157d30  EFLAGS: 00010082
RAX: 0000000000000100 RBX: ffffe200016e00f8 RCX: 0000000000000001
RDX: 0000000000000000 RSI: 0000000000000000 RDI: 0000000000000018
RBP: ffff88007e157d30 R08: ffff88007f986c00 R09: 000000000afd1261
R10: 0000000000000000 R11: 0000000000000000 R12: 0000000000000000
R13: 0000000000000000 R14: 0000000000000018 R15: ffff88007f986c00
FS:  0000000000000000(0000) GS:ffff880001010000(0000) knlGS:0000000000000000
CS:  0010 DS: 0018 ES: 0018 CR0: 000000008005003b
CR2: 0000000000000018 CR3: 000000007f9f6000 CR4: 00000000000406e0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
Process reiserfs/0 (pid: 1551, threadinfo ffff88007e156000, task
ffff88007ed49bd0)
Stack:
 ffff88007e157d60 ffffffff802c19a0 ffff880067922930 0000000000000000
 ffff88007d318180 0000000000000000 ffff88007e157d80 ffffffff802c1a96
 0000000000000000 ffffc200098d94c0 ffff88007e157e00 ffffffff80316a03
Call Trace:
 [<ffffffff802c19a0>] __set_page_dirty+0x30/0xd0
 [<ffffffff802c1a96>] mark_buffer_dirty+0x56/0xa0
 [<ffffffff80316a03>] flush_commit_list+0x713/0x720
 [<ffffffff805c2231>] ? thread_return+0x3e/0x66d
 [<ffffffff803165ee>] flush_commit_list+0x2fe/0x720
 [<ffffffff80316b24>] flush_async_commits+0x54/0x70
 [<ffffffff80316ad0>] ? flush_async_commits+0x0/0x70
 [<ffffffff8024b6cc>] worker_thread+0x11c/0x1f0
 [<ffffffff8024fa20>] ? autoremove_wake_function+0x0/0x40
 [<ffffffff8024b5b0>] ? worker_thread+0x0/0x1f0
 [<ffffffff8024b5b0>] ? worker_thread+0x0/0x1f0
 [<ffffffff8024f616>] kthread+0x56/0x90
 [<ffffffff8020c2ba>] child_rip+0xa/0x20
 [<ffffffff8024f5c0>] ? kthread+0x0/0x90
 [<ffffffff8020c2b0>] ? child_rip+0x0/0x20
Code: 90 55 48 89 e5 9c 58 fa ba 00 01 00 00 f0 66 0f c1 17 38 f2 74
06 f3 90 8a 17 eb f6 c9 c3 66 66 90 55 48 89 e5 fa b8 00 01 00 00 <f0>
66 0f c1 07 38 e0 74 06 f3 90 8a 07 eb f6 c9 c3 66 66 90 66
RIP  [<ffffffff805c456a>] _spin_lock_irq+0xa/0x20
 RSP <ffff88007e157d30>
CR2: 0000000000000018
---[ end trace 0c4afebe89587152 ]---
------------[ cut here ]------------
WARNING: at kernel/exit.c:896 do_exit+0x601/0x730()
Hardware name: EP45T-DS3
Pid: 1551, comm: reiserfs/0 Tainted: G      D    2.6.30.1-netconsole #1
Call Trace:
 [<ffffffff8023d811>] ? do_exit+0x601/0x730
 [<ffffffff80239b43>] warn_slowpath_common+0x73/0xc0
 [<ffffffff80239b9f>] warn_slowpath_null+0xf/0x20
 [<ffffffff8023d811>] do_exit+0x601/0x730
 [<ffffffff8020f5db>] oops_end+0x9b/0xa0
 [<ffffffff80226c48>] no_context+0xe8/0x260
 [<ffffffff8023017a>] ? dequeue_task_fair+0x4a/0x1d0
 [<ffffffff80226f05>] __bad_area_nosemaphore+0x145/0x1e0
 [<ffffffff805c2261>] ? thread_return+0x6e/0x66d
 [<ffffffff803c108e>] ? cfq_insert_request+0x37e/0x3a0
 [<ffffffff80226fae>] bad_area_nosemaphore+0xe/0x10
 [<ffffffff80227337>] do_page_fault+0x1c7/0x280
 [<ffffffff805c4a7f>] page_fault+0x1f/0x30
 [<ffffffff805c456a>] ? _spin_lock_irq+0xa/0x20
 [<ffffffff802c19a0>] __set_page_dirty+0x30/0xd0
 [<ffffffff802c1a96>] mark_buffer_dirty+0x56/0xa0
 [<ffffffff80316a03>] flush_commit_list+0x713/0x720
 [<ffffffff805c2231>] ? thread_return+0x3e/0x66d
 [<ffffffff803165ee>] flush_commit_list+0x2fe/0x720
 [<ffffffff80316b24>] flush_async_commits+0x54/0x70
 [<ffffffff80316ad0>] ? flush_async_commits+0x0/0x70
 [<ffffffff8024b6cc>] worker_thread+0x11c/0x1f0
 [<ffffffff8024fa20>] ? autoremove_wake_function+0x0/0x40
 [<ffffffff8024b5b0>] ? worker_thread+0x0/0x1f0
 [<ffffffff8024b5b0>] ? worker_thread+0x0/0x1f0
 [<ffffffff8024f616>] kthread+0x56/0x90
 [<ffffffff8020c2ba>] child_rip+0xa/0x20
 [<ffffffff8024f5c0>] ? kthread+0x0/0x90
 [<ffffffff8020c2b0>] ? child_rip+0x0/0x20
---[ end trace 0c4afebe89587153 ]---

Michael Uleysky
--
To unsubscribe from this list: send the line "unsubscribe reiserfs-devel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html

[Index of Archives]     [Linux File System Development]     [Linux BTRFS]     [Linux NFS]     [Linux Filesystems]     [Ext4 Filesystem]     [Kernel Newbies]     [Share Photos]     [Security]     [Netfilter]     [Bugtraq]     [Yosemite Forum]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Samba]     [Device Mapper]     [Linux Resources]

  Powered by Linux